Difference between revisions of "Courier-Authlib"

From CBLFS
Jump to navigationJump to search
(Added courier user/group.)
Line 8: Line 8:
  
 
{{Package-Introduction|Courier's mail server authorization library.}}
 
{{Package-Introduction|Courier's mail server authorization library.}}
 +
 +
== Creating the courier User & Group ==
 +
 +
groupadd -g ''35'' ''courier'' &&
 +
useradd -c "''Courier Daemon User''" -d /dev/null \
 +
        -u ''35'' -g ''courier'' -s /bin/false ''courier''
  
 
== Dependencies ==
 
== Dependencies ==
Line 16: Line 22:
  
 
== Non-Multilib ==
 
== Non-Multilib ==
 +
 +
Compile the package:
  
 
  ./configure --prefix=/usr --libexecdir=/usr/sbin \
 
  ./configure --prefix=/usr --libexecdir=/usr/sbin \
Line 21: Line 29:
 
  --with-mailgroup=courier
 
  --with-mailgroup=courier
 
  make
 
  make
 +
 +
Install the package:
  
 
  make install
 
  make install
Line 33: Line 43:
 
=== 64Bit ===
 
=== 64Bit ===
  
 +
== Configuring ==
  
 
+
{|style="text-align: left"
== Configuring ==
+
|-valign="top"
 +
!Installed Directories:
 +
|/etc/courier,/etc/courier/authlib,/usr/lib/courier-authlib,/usr/sbin/courier-authlib
 +
|-valign="top"
 +
!Installed Programs:
 +
|courierauthconfig,authdaemond,authpasswd,makedatprog,authsystem.passwd,authenumerate,userdbpw,pw2userdb,authtest,userdb,vchkpw2userdb,courierlogger,makeuserdb,userdb-test-cram-md5
 +
|-valign="top"
 +
!Installed Libraries:
 +
|libauthcustom.so,libauthpipe.so,libauthpam.so,libauthuserdb.so,libcourierauth.so,libcourierauthsaslclient.so,libauthpipe.so,libcourierauthsasl.so,libcourierauth.so,libcourierauthcommon.so,libauthcustom.so,libauthldap.so,libauthldap.so,libauthmysql.so,libauthmysql.so,libcourierauthcommon.so,libcourierauthsaslclient.so,libauthuserdb.so,libauthpam.so,libcourierauthsasl.so
 +
|}

Revision as of 19:50, 7 October 2007

Download Source: http://prdownloads.sourceforge.net/courier/courier-authlib-0.59.1.tar.bz2

Introduction to Courier-Authlib

Courier's mail server authorization library.

Project Homepage: Unknown

Creating the courier User & Group

groupadd -g 35 courier &&
useradd -c "Courier Daemon User" -d /dev/null \
       -u 35 -g courier -s /bin/false courier

Dependencies

Required

Non-Multilib

Compile the package:

./configure --prefix=/usr --libexecdir=/usr/sbin \
--sysconfdir=/etc/courier/authlib --with-mailuser=courier \
--with-mailgroup=courier
make

Install the package:

make install
make install-configure

Multilib

32Bit

N32

64Bit

Configuring

Installed Directories: /etc/courier,/etc/courier/authlib,/usr/lib/courier-authlib,/usr/sbin/courier-authlib
Installed Programs: courierauthconfig,authdaemond,authpasswd,makedatprog,authsystem.passwd,authenumerate,userdbpw,pw2userdb,authtest,userdb,vchkpw2userdb,courierlogger,makeuserdb,userdb-test-cram-md5
Installed Libraries: libauthcustom.so,libauthpipe.so,libauthpam.so,libauthuserdb.so,libcourierauth.so,libcourierauthsaslclient.so,libauthpipe.so,libcourierauthsasl.so,libcourierauth.so,libcourierauthcommon.so,libauthcustom.so,libauthldap.so,libauthldap.so,libauthmysql.so,libauthmysql.so,libcourierauthcommon.so,libcourierauthsaslclient.so,libauthuserdb.so,libauthpam.so,libcourierauthsasl.so